Protecting Yourself from Heatstroke: Practical Tips
Protecting yourself from heatstroke during this Delhi heatwave requires proactive measures. Simple steps can significantly reduce your risk. Remember, staying hydrated is crucial for heatwave safety.
- Drink plenty of fluids: Water is best, but you can also consume ORS (Oral Rehydration Salts) or electrolyte drinks.
- Wear light-colored, loose-fitting clothing: This allows your body to breathe and stay cool.
- Avoid strenuous activity during peak hours: Schedule outdoor activities for early mornings or evenings.
- Seek shade whenever possible: Utilize trees, buildings, or awnings for respite from the sun.
- Use sunscreen with a high SPF: Protect your skin from harmful UV rays.
- Check on elderly neighbors and vulnerable populations: Ensure that those most at risk are safe and have access to cool environments and hydration.
Recognizing and Treating Heatstroke Symptoms
Recognizing the symptoms of heatstroke and heat exhaustion is crucial for prompt intervention. Early detection can save lives. Remember, heatstroke treatment requires immediate medical attention.
- Heatstroke symptoms: High body temperature (above 103°F or 39.4°C), confusion, rapid pulse, headache, dizziness, nausea, vomiting, seizures, loss of consciousness.
- Heat exhaustion symptoms: Heavy sweating, weakness, dizziness, headache, nausea, muscle cramps.
- Steps to take if someone experiences heatstroke or heat exhaustion: Immediately move the person to a cool place, provide fluids (if conscious), and call emergency services (dial 108 in India).
